New Blind Observatory EP

Berlin based sonic stargazer Blind Observatory is back with an absorbing new EP on Gravitational. Aptly described as a 'well written space opera' it is a widescreen deep techno offering with stirring and emotional chords, twinkling melodic stars and a far-gazing melancholic feel to each track that really stays with you. New Donato Dozzy remix

The revered Italian sound sculptor and Spazio Disponibile boss has remixed Leo Anibaldi for a new EP on Cannibald. It finds him layering up spiralling, circling synths and smooth rubber drums into spaced out and cosmic soundscapes that will have you lost in your own mind. DJ Nobu XLR8R podcast

Japanese favourite DJ Nobu has the honour of marking the tenth anniversary of the XLR8R podcast series. For the occasion, the Future Terror promoter and Bitta label boss has served up three hours of music recorded live at a conceptual festival in the Japanese mountains.
